Softball Recap: Buffalo Bison vs. St. Michael-Albertville Knights

Suggested Video

Buffalo was not able to break out of their rough patch on Wednesday as the team picked up their 11th straight loss. They came up short against the St. Michael-Albertville Knights, falling 16-1.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against the Knights this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 6-3 two weeks ago.

Buffalo sa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Avery Bjorklund, who went 1-for-2 with one double.

Buffalo's defeat dropped their record down to 2-16. As for St. Michael-Albertville, the victory made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 11-5.

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Buffalo will square off against Big Lake at 5: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for St. Michael-Albertville, they will face off against Rogers at 4:30 p.m. on Thursday. The Royals will roll in looking for their ninth straight win, something the Knights surely won't give up without a fight.
